On her science test, Shawn correctly answered 66 out of 78 questions. What percent of the questions did she answer correctly?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Mrrafil [7]4 years ago
6 0
To figure out percetages on tests, divide the number of questions answered correctly by the total number of questions. 

66 ÷ 78 = 0.85

Next, move the decimal point over two places.

0.85 = 85%

Shawn got 85% on the science test.
